Netflix via US DNS not working

Hi all

 

Have been combing the forums looking for an answer but nothing I have found has worked for me so far, and many of the responses to others queries were to start a new post and to provide appropriate information to allow the mods to help. So here I am. Basically, when I set up my system to use either my DNS or the google DNS everything works fine however I only have access to the Australian Netflix catalog. When I add the Unblock Us DNS to the settings config as per below Netflix does not load at all.

 

I am running a VPN on my PMS machine, and I presume that is where the issues are coming from. I am using SlykVPN to connect to a VPN outside of Australia (for obvious reasons to anyone from Australia, or following Australian news lately). This VPN currently gives my machine a local IP of 10.1.0.14, and a DNS of 10.1.0.1 - this changes every hour but is always an address outside of Australia.

 
  • ATV3
  • DNS on ATV = 192.168.1.20 (IP of machine running PMS)
  • Main PC running Windows 7 SP1 (device is running as my tor box and never turns itself off overnight etc)
  • PMS v 2.3.24
  • local IP of PMS machine = 192.168.1.20
  • PlexConnect synced via GitHub lastnight (21.04.15 at ~10pm)

 

*SETTINGS*

 

[PlexConnect]
enable_plexgdm = False
ip_pms = 192.168.1.20
port_pms = 32400
enable_dnsserver = True
port_dnsserver = 53
ip_dnsmaster = *unblockus DNS*
prevent_atv_update = False
enable_plexconnect_autodetect = False
ip_plexconnect = 192.168.1.20
hosttointercept = trailers.apple.com
port_webserver = 80
enable_webserver_ssl = True
port_ssl = 443
certfile = ./assets/certificates/trailers.pem
allow_gzip_atv = False
allow_gzip_pmslocal = False
allow_gzip_pmsremote = True
loglevel = High
logpath = .
 
I have tried toggling enable_plexgdm and enable_plexconnect_autodetect but for some reason the set up works much better when they are off. Also I turned off the prevent_atv_update to see if I could get rid of netflix update nag message. But it always fails to update...
 
Here is my log after trying to open the Netflix app with the Unblock us DNS set up.
 
http://pastebin.com/sKHyqpTW
 
*SETTINGS
 
[PlexConnect]
enable_plexgdm = False
ip_pms = 192.168.1.20
port_pms = 32400
enable_dnsserver = True
port_dnsserver = 53
ip_dnsmaster = 8.8.8.8
prevent_atv_update = True
enable_plexconnect_autodetect = False
ip_plexconnect = 192.168.1.20
hosttointercept = trailers.apple.com
port_webserver = 80
enable_webserver_ssl = True
port_ssl = 443
certfile = ./assets/certificates/trailers.pem
allow_gzip_atv = False
allow_gzip_pmslocal = False
allow_gzip_pmsremote = True
loglevel = High
logpath = .
 
Here is my log with everything working, however with access to only the Australian Netflix (no DNS spoofing).
 

 

Am I doing something wrong, or is it simply not possible to connect to the US netflix catalog, whilst also using plex connect and having a VPN set up on my main machine for privacy?

 

Thanks!

 

EDIT: Also, do I need to update my location to United States within the atv to access the US netflix catalog?

 

EDIT2: It looks like UnBlockUS is the issue - just tried a DNS from tvunblock and it work fine with current set up (tested with PMS machine VPN on and off). Mods feel free to delete this whole topic...